Book Synopsis

But soft, what light through yonder window breaks? It is the east, and Juliet is the sun… A beautiful retelling of Shakespeare’s most famous love story. With Notes on Shakespeare and the Globe Theatre and Love and Hate in Romeo and Juliet. The tales have been retold using accessible language and with the help of Tony Ross’s engaging black-and-white illustrations, each play is vividly brought to life allowing these culturally enriching stories to be shared with as wide an audience as possible.

Our Review Panel says...

The story of Romeo and Juliet has been retold in narrative form, using simple language to make it accessible for children. This series, which includes other Shakespeare titles, provides an excellent way to introduce the plot and characters from each play in a way that young children can follow.
